Cricket: Talbots sign new coach

Sudbury Cricket Club have signed Jandre Coetzee from the Griqualand West/Eagles as club coach for the 2009 season.
Coetzee is a pace left-arm seam bowler and hard-hitting batsmen as well as being an experienced coach.

Coetzee, 24, was top of the bowling averages and third in the batting averages as Griqualand West won the SAA provincial first class trophy last year.

He also played in the Supersport Series for the Eagles.

Coetzee was one of the top bowlers in the South Africa Twenty20 tournament and leading Twenty20 wicket-taker for the Eagles in season 2007/8.

He will join the Friars Street club in April 2009.
